Description
Upon entering, you are welcomed into a generous front reception room which flows seamlessly into a second reception space. Both rooms are bright and versatile, offering excellent flexibility to create a comfortable living area, dining space, home office, or a combination to suit your lifestyle.
To the rear of the property is a well-appointed kitchen featuring ample storage and worktop space, making it practical for everyday living.
Externally, the property boasts a larger-than-average courtyard making it perfect for outdoor seating and entertaining during the warmer months. Whether you enjoy relaxing in the sunshine or hosting friends, this outdoor space offers excellent potential.
Upstairs, the property continues to impress with two well-sized bedrooms. The master bedroom is a spacious double with plenty of room for wardrobes and additional furniture. The second bedroom is a generous single and conveniently includes a fitted wardrobe. The family bathroom is located off the landing and is larger than typically found in similar properties, complete with a bathtub and overhead shower.
Situated within walking distance of Hanley City Centre, the property benefits from excellent access to shops, restaurants, local amenities and transport links, making it ideal for professionals, couples or small families.

Alternative Deposit Option is available with Reposit!
The Reposit fee is non-refundable and cannot be offset against costs at the end of tenancy. Just like with a normal deposit, you remain liable for any outstanding amounts due to the landlord at the end of your tenancy (e.g. cleaning fees, costs for repairs, outstanding rent), but with Reposit you only pay if they actually occur, rather than paying upfront. In case of a dispute, you will be charged £60 which will be refunded to you if your dispute is successful.
Subject to a minimum fee of £150 EPC rating: C.
